neem oil , 50%ISO/50%water, safer soap, The link in my sig are all weapons to fight bugs , Try 50%ISO(isopropyl alcohol 70 or 90%) 50% water a few drops dish detergent
Spray completely let dry and spray again. Watch plants and repeat or try different treatment. By using different treatments bugs can not build up a resisent to them, so they will die off better and less change of them returning.

i nuked my chamber with neem+soap+iso+h2o2 3 imes a day for 3 days, then went on vacation and didn't water for 4 days and it totally eradicated them. i had also added a humidifier.

by nuke i mean spraying bottom and top until i was slipping on the cement floor cause of how much had rained off. used bout 2L/session.
 
be swift man, within 3 days of the mites showing, i had 4/5 plants herm on me 5th week of flower, 17th week total:O
